Türkçesi -di’li geçmiş zaman olan tensimiz. Kullanımı oldukça kolay aslında. Simple Past Tense’de biz, fillerin ikinci halini kullanıyoruz ve bunları bilmemiz gerekiyor.

Olumlu cümle yapısı:

I/You/We/They + V2
He/She/It+ V2

Olumsuz cümle yapısı:

I/You/We/They + did not (didn’t) + V1
He/She/It + did not (didn’t) + V1

Soru cümle yapısı:

Did + I/You/We/They + V1
Did + He/She/It + V1

Simple Past Tense’te, was/were ile bir cümle kullanıyorsak, cümle içinde, yardımcı fiil olarak davranabilir. Fakat bu durum, Present Continuous Tense'deki was/were ile karıştırılmamalıdır.

I was a teacher.
Where was he?
My keys were on the table.
I wasn’t at my uncle’s last night.
I was in the army two years ago.
Richard was her father.
He was in England 2 years ago.
They were in Germany.

Bazı durumlarda, olumlu cümlelerde de “did” yardımcı fiili kullanılabilir. Bu şekilde kullanımlar, yapılan eylemin yapıldığını vurgulamak için kullanılır. Bu tarz cümlelerde, olumlu cümlelerde de fiilin birinci hali kullanılır.

I did love you.
I did clean the house.
I did run really fast.
He did fly away!
We did have a wonderful time at the beach!
She did bake the most delicious cookies I’ve ever tasted!
They did manage to finish the project on time.
I did see a shooting star last night!

EXAMPLE

He cleaned the house yesterday.
She washed her car in the garage last week.
It ate a banana last month.
I knew the answer a few minutes ago.
Leonardo painted the Mona Lisa.
She went to the theatre last week.
You drank lemonade in the garden yesterday morning.
We played soccer at school the other day.
They danced in the prom in 2020.
We visited China in 2019.
They weren’t in Rio last summer.
We didn’t have any money.
We didn’t have time to visit the Eiffel Tower.
We didn’t do our exercises this morning.
Were they in Iceland last January?
Did you have a bicycle when you were young?
Did you do much climbing in Switzerland?
